But is it worth the investment? <\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">We spoke with accessibility consultant <\/span><a href=\"https:\/\/www.wuhcag.com\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Luke McGrath<\/span><\/a><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">, who made it clear that the answer is \u201cyes.\u201d<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Here are five reasons why your company should invest in web accessibility.<\/span><\/p>\n<h2><b>Grow Your Reach<\/b><\/h2>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">\u201cAround a fifth of people have some form of disability, ranging from severe impairment of one or more senses to minor reduction in ability,\u201d McGrath says. \u201cThe more accessible a website is, the greater the chance these users can complete the tasks they want to, whether that\u2019s joining your newsletter or buying something from your store. Simply put, web accessibility will save you lost conversions.\u201d<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Cumulatively, inaccessible websites contribute to the \u201cdigital divide\u201d\u2014the gap between those who have access and those who don\u2019t. A recent Pew Research report found that Americans with disabilities were <\/span><a href=\"http:\/\/www.pewresearch.org\/fact-tank\/2017\/04\/07\/disabled-americans-are-less-likely-to-use-technology\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">three times as likely<\/span><\/a><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">\u00a0to say they never go online. Even after controlling for age, people with disabilities are taking up technology at lower rates. What could be discouraging them? Either it\u2019s the very real inability to get something of value out of it, or it\u2019s the perception of inability.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">The ways accessibility grows your reach don\u2019t stop with people living with disabilities. Sometimes, impediments lie not with people, but with the technology they\u2019re using. \u201cUsers with slow internet connections,\u201d McGrath says, \u201cand those on mobiles, and even those who are unfamiliar with the web\u2014all benefit from clear and accessible websites.\u201d<\/span><\/p>\n<h2><b>Project Your Company Values<\/b><\/h2>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">When it comes to representation in media, we\u2019re conscious of the need to be inclusive\u2014you wouldn\u2019t want it to seem like your product is intended only for a certain type of person, right? Reputations are easy to damage, and very hard to recover.\u201d<\/span><\/p>\n<h2><b>Boost Your Effectiveness<\/b><\/h2>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Whatever your site or app is attempting to do\u2014whether that\u2019s sell products or simply deliver content\u2014it has to be legible. That\u2019s something that affects how easy it is to navigate a site and find what you want, but also how easy it is to extract information once you find it.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Pale grey type on a white background may look sophisticated\u2014but you don\u2019t have to be visually impaired to find it difficult to make out. Eyestrain is real, especially when reading from a tiny screen. And while multitouch that lets users zoom in can help, it\u2019s of limited usefulness if your text doesn\u2019t reflow\u2014and no help at all to someone browsing from a desktop.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Legibility doesn\u2019t end with a site\u2019s appearance, either. It\u2019s also affected by how information is organized. If your point is to convey your ideas, why not make them digestible? Keep it short! Put it in bullets! For people with learning or cognitive disabilities, this could be the difference between whether or not the information is retained. For people with no impairments, it could be the difference between whether or not they\u2019re engaged enough to keep reading.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">\u201cAn accessible site helps every user,\u201d McGrath confirms. \u201cIt enforces clarity, simplicity, and ease of use. As a result, everyone can get what they want from the site regardless of ability\u2014I can\u2019t imagine why a business would restrict any user.\u201d<\/span><\/p>\n<h2><b>Stay Flexible<\/b><\/h2>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">A website with an animated splash page designed to look spectacular at 1366 \u00d7 768 pixels is a wonderful thing to have\u2014but if it\u2019s not responsive, how\u2019s it going to look on someone\u2019s phone, where the screen ratio isn\u2019t the same? In fact, the <\/span><a href=\"http:\/\/gs.statcounter.com\/screen-resolution-stats\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">most popular screen resolution<\/span><\/a><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> today is 360 \u00d7 640 pixels\u2014which is taller than it is wide. If the way you present your content can\u2019t adapt, all your intricate design work is for naught.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">In fact, many people who don\u2019t consider themselves disabled still choose to engage with accessibility features\u2014people who prefer keystrokes to reaching for a mouse, or find laptop trackpads annoying; people in noisy areas who turn on captions to help them understand what people in a video are saying. <\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">More is not always more; rich media can look impressive, but if they depend on a specific type of interaction or display, or if they slow down your site, then many people may not be able to access them\u2014or care to. On the other hand, if your site can be accessed by a wide range of different people and technologies, odds are good it can do lots of other things as well.<\/span><\/p>\n<h2><b>Lower Your Costs<\/b><\/h2>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Keeping a website responsive means constant updates. If your site is \u201cperfect\u201d but rigid, then every change you make is going mean overhauling the entire thing, which quickly gets time consuming and costly. As McGrath explains, \u201cOver-engineering a website often leads to extra expenses in maintenance costs and training time for staff, and more bugs and errors. Cut those out, and you gain back time and money\u2014two resources you can then put into building your business.\u201d<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">On a fundamental level, baking in accessibility boosts a site\u2019s flexibility, which can improve your efficiency with everything from re-designing user interfaces, making pages responsive to different browser types and screen ratios, helping pages to communicate with off-site business solutions, and even packing in more SEO-boosting measures.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">But also consider the fact that the everyday use and maintenance of your site is being performed by human beings\u2014and human beings mean human error. It\u2019s one thing to lose a customer because they can\u2019t access your content. It\u2019s another to waste your employees\u2019 time because they can\u2019t decipher the code or markup they\u2019re working with. Improve legibility, and you reduce head-scratching\u2014and errors.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">\u201cOne of the great things about building for accessibility is it makes you think about what you really need and the best way to implement it,\u201d McGrath says. \u201cSimplifying your interface (both back-end CMS and front-end pages) makes it easier, faster, and therefore less costly to maintain.\u201d<\/span><\/p>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>Is web accessibility worth the investment?
